Job Advert Summary:
To develop electronics graduate through practical exposure to industrial control, instrumentation, and automation systems used in cement manufacturing. The graduate trainee – electronics engineering will support the maintenance and improvement of electronic systems that enable stable, safe, and efficient plant operations.
Minimum Requirements:
Bachelor’s degree in Electronics , Electrical , Instrumentation Engineering, or related discipline.
Duties and Responsibilities:
- Assist in maintaining and troubleshooting instrumentation, sensors, transmitters, analysers, controllers, PLCs, and other automation-related systems.
- Support calibration, loop checks, signal testing, and basic fault diagnosis for process control and monitoring systems.
- Participate in plant automation and control improvement initiatives aimed at enhancing process stability, efficiency, and product quality.
- Assist with documenting control logic updates, maintenance findings, calibration records, and technical reports.
- Work with senior engineers and technicians to investigate faults affecting control systems, instrumentation signals, and electronic equipment performance.
- Support commissioning, testing, and performance verification of electronic and control equipment during shutdowns or projects.
- Observe all safety, isolation, and quality procedures when working on live or field-installed systems.
- Contribute to reliability, data logging, and continuous improvement initiatives involving automation and digital systems.
